Student Career/College Success Manager
Niobrara Public Schools has a grant position opening for the 22-23 school year for a Full Time Student Success Coordinator. Candidates that have experience working with youth and willing to build healthy relationships while exploring job and college opportunities are asked to apply.
Student Success Coordinator will be supervising up to three other Part Time Success Coaches while ensuring that Native American students have multiple opportunities to explore careers and colleges.

TITLE: Student Success Coach
REPORTS TO: Administration
SUPERVISES: Student Mentors
JOB FUNCTION: This position provides support, leadership and guidance to students, families, teachers, counselors and administration to ensure each student graduates on time and is prepared for career and/or college success.
Duties and Responsibilities:
-
Provide guidance to students to make more informed and better educational and career choices by providing information on high school course and program offerings, career options, type of academic and occupational training needed to succeed in the workplace, and post-secondary opportunities associated with fields of interest including completion of individualized learning plans or post-secondary plans.
-
Provide teachers, administrators and parents/families with information and tools to support students’ career exploration and post-secondary educational opportunities.
-
Promote career readiness and an integral component to college readiness and promote both 2- and 4- year post secondary options.
-
Work with teachers to incorporate and promote career/college readiness goals in classroom instruction for all students.
-
Coordinate and oversee programs/activities to educate parents/ families of all students on career/college readiness topics including, but not limited to, high school academic offerings, career exploration, post-secondary applications processes, post secondary financial resources.
-
Coordinate special program/activities to introduce students to high school course and program offerings, career options and post secondary options.
-
Provide increased accountability by tracking, assessing, analyzing and reporting data to monitor student success. Support data and reporting needs.
-
Provide consistent emphasis on and support for post-secondary and career exploration and preparation through both formal and informal student events and activities.
-
Work with faculty, staff and students to develop and implement formal and informal student events and activities that enhance a college and career school culture.
-
Remain aware of District and community needs and initiate activities to meet thos identified needs.
-
Attend meetings, maintain regular attendance and perform other duties as assigned.
